DeepSeek, a Chinese Artificial Intelligence (AI) startup, took the world by storm when it topped the free app download charts in the US, leading to decline of tech stocks there with Nasdaq tanking 3% a few weeks back.
DeepSeek unseated OpenAI’s ChatGPT to be at the top in Apple’s App Store. The impact of its success was so great that it made US President Donald Trump describing it as "a wake-up call" for the American tech industry, while Vice President JD Vance, without mentioning DeepSeek in his remarks at the recently concluded AI Action Summit in Paris, emphasised how big of a priority it is for his country to lead the sector.
These reactions suggest that there is now a fear among world leaders that a more affordable AI model from China could challenge the dominance of US tech companies. Its dominance in no time raised questions over Microsoft, Google, Meta, and Alphabet spending billions in planning their AI platforms.

Cost: DeepSeek's R1 AI model was made at low cost
The most important point that made headlines was DeepSeek’s R1 AI model, which was made at a fraction of the cost of its rivals and can roughly match the performance of Open AI’s o1 model, as claimed by the company. The DeepSeek-V3 model was developed with an investment of only $5.6 Mn.
However, the cost of using AI models has already plummeted, making them increasingly accessible to enterprises, according to a report by EY released last month. “OpenAI’s GPT API costs, for example, have dropped nearly 80% in two years, while open-source releases like Meta’s Llama are unlocking new capabilities. Assuming that the cost is US$4 per Mn tokens and the application uses 100 tokens per second continuously, the enterprise would spend US$1.44 per hour, the report said.
Security concerns: New research highlights ties with the Chinese government
According to media reports, security analysts have uncovered an obfuscated code within its chatbot web login page. It appears that this establishes connections with China Mobile, a state-owned telecommunications company banned from operating in the US due to national security concerns. After this, many US lawmakers has demanded the DeepSeek app to be banned from US government devices.
Further, a survey revealed that about half of the Dutch population is sceptical about DeepSeek’s reliability and privacy practices. The study, conducted by Onderneming.nl, found that 48% of Dutch users expressed concerns about their personal data protection with DeepSeek as compared to OpenAI’s ChatGPT. About 63% of Dutch users make use of AI services like ChatGPT or Copilot, revealed the study.
